node mcu上使用ad转换

因为node mcu只有一个ad转换的接口
即A0
所以我们将对应设备接在A0即可

#define ADC_port A0                                //将A0宏定义为ADC_port

int numcount = 20;                                 //定义采集次数
unsigned int reading[20];                          //定义一个数组存储采集的数据      
int count = 0;                                     //定义一个记次变量
unsigned long AnalogValueTotal = 0;                //采集数据总和
unsigned int AnalogAverage = 0,averageVoltage=0;   //采集数据均值、换算电压均值
float ADC_read = 0;                                //ADC采集最后结果                                   

void setup() {
  // put your setup code here, to run once:
  Serial.begin(115200);                            //串口初始化
  for (count = 0;count < numcount;count++)         //存储数组清零
    reading[count] = 0;
}

void loop() {
  // put your main code here, to run repeatedly:
  for (count = 0 ; count<numcount ; count++)       //循环读取ADC值并存储到数组中求和
      {
        reading[count] = analogRead(ADC_port);     //读取adc              
        AnalogValueTotal = AnalogValueTotal + reading[count];  //叠加
      }
    AnalogAverage = AnalogValueTotal / numcount;   //计算平均值
    float adc = AnalogAverage*(float)3300/1024;    //转换为电压
    AnalogAverage = 0;                             //平均值清零
    AnalogValueTotal= 0;                           //采样求和值清零
    Serial.print("Dianliu:");
    Serial.println(adc,3);                         //串口输出采样值
    
    delay(100);                                    //延时100ms
}
